Output 604e79889fe047f4f0be650c1ca17b8b024a6fe0b557f5dba5a18d15efc92c7f:0

value
1366745698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23880d86aaf2a2711ce4675bedabb5b5c3c506b0 OP_EQUAL
address
34vtZNgPsE46dwG1kCNHPhSShoxPfze7uS
transaction
604e79889fe047f4f0be650c1ca17b8b024a6fe0b557f5dba5a18d15efc92c7f
spent
true